Managed by Global X Management Company LLC, the Global X Zero Coupon Bond 2031 ETF is an exchange-traded fund. Its investment focus is dedicated to the U.S. fixed-income market, specifically acquiring U.S. dollar-denominated zero-coupon U.S. Treasury securities. These chosen bonds are scheduled to mature on or about November 30, 2031. The fund's primary objective is to replicate the performance of the FTSE Zero Coupon U.S. Treasury STRIPS 2030 Maturity Index, which it achieves by employing a representative sampling methodology. This investment vehicle is legally domiciled in the United States.
